如何运行asp网站

运行ASP网站首先需安装IIS服务器,确保系统支持ASP。在IIS管理器中创建网站,配置网站目录和端口。上传ASP文件至指定目录,设置正确的权限。启动网站并访问URL进行测试。注意防火墙设置,确保端口开放。使用浏览器访问,检查网站功能是否正常。

imagesource from: pexels

引言:深入理解ASP网站及其运行步骤

ASP(Active Server Pages)网站,作为Web开发的重要技术之一,在现代网络开发中扮演着不可或缺的角色。它允许开发者使用服务器端脚本语言,如VBScript或JScript,来创建动态交互式网页。本文将简要介绍ASP网站的概念,概述其运行的基本步骤,并提供详细的指导和实用技巧,帮助您轻松掌握ASP网站的运行方法,激发您对Web开发的热情。跟随本文,您将了解到如何从安装IIS服务器开始,逐步创建、配置并测试ASP网站,确保其顺利运行。让我们一同踏上这段探索之旅吧!

一、准备工作:安装与配置IIS服务器

在开始运行ASP网站之前,准备工作至关重要。其中,安装和配置IIS服务器是第一步。以下是具体步骤:

1、选择合适的操作系统

首先,选择一款支持ASP操作的操作系统。目前,Windows Server系列操作系统是最常用的选择。特别是Windows Server 2012及以上版本,它们提供了对ASP的最新支持和优化。

操作系统版本 ASP支持情况
Windows Server 2012 支持
Windows Server 2016 支持
Windows Server 2019 支持

2、下载并安装IIS服务器

在选择了合适的操作系统后,接下来是下载并安装IIS服务器。以下是具体步骤:

  1. 访问Microsoft官网,进入IIS服务器下载页面。
  2. 下载适用于您操作系统的IIS安装程序。
  3. 运行安装程序,按照提示完成安装。

3、配置IIS服务器基本设置

安装完成后,需要配置IIS服务器的基本设置。以下是几个关键设置:

  • 网站标识:设置网站的名称和绑定地址。
  • 物理路径:指定ASP文件所在的目录。
  • 应用程序池:选择或创建一个应用程序池,用于托管网站。
  • 处理器亲和性:配置IIS应用程序池的处理器亲和性,提高网站性能。

通过以上步骤,您的IIS服务器就基本配置完成了。接下来,您就可以继续创建和配置ASP网站了。

二、创建与配置ASP网站

在完成IIS服务器的安装和配置之后,下一步就是创建和配置ASP网站。这一部分是整个网站搭建过程中的核心,直接影响到网站的运行效果。以下是详细的步骤和技巧。

1、在IIS管理器中创建新网站

首先,打开IIS管理器,在左侧树状结构中选择对应的服务器名称。在右侧的操作区域中,点击“添加网站”按钮,开始创建新的ASP网站。

步骤 描述
1 选择服务器并点击“添加网站”按钮
2 填写网站名称和物理路径
3 设置网站绑定信息,包括IP地址、端口和主机名
4 点击“确定”完成创建

2、设置网站目录与端口

创建网站后,需要设置网站的目录和端口。在IIS管理器中,右键点击新创建的网站,选择“绑定”选项,进入网站绑定设置。

步骤 描述
1 右键点击网站,选择“绑定”
2 在“网站绑定”界面,添加或修改绑定信息,包括IP地址、端口和主机名
3 点击“确定”保存设置

3、上传ASP文件至服务器目录

将ASP文件上传到之前设置的网站目录中。可以使用FTP软件或网络资源管理器完成上传。

步骤 描述
1 使用FTP软件或网络资源管理器上传ASP文件
2 确保文件路径与网站目录一致

完成以上步骤后,一个基本的ASP网站就已经搭建完成。但为了确保网站正常运行,还需要进行权限设置和防火墙配置。接下来,我们将探讨这两个方面的内容。

三、权限设置与防火墙配置

在成功创建ASP网站后,权限设置和防火墙配置是保障网站安全运行的关键步骤。

1. 设置网站目录权限

正确设置网站目录权限可以有效防止未经授权的访问和潜在的安全威胁。以下是一些常见的权限设置:

权限类型 描述
读取 允许用户读取网站文件和目录内容
写入 允许用户修改网站文件和目录内容
执行 允许用户运行网站应用程序
列出 允许用户查看网站文件和目录列表

根据实际需求,您可以在IIS管理器中为网站目录设置相应的权限。以下是一个示例表格:

目录路径 权限设置
/wwwroot/ 读取、写入、执行
/wwwroot/images/ 读取
/wwwroot/script/ 执行

2. 配置防火墙以开放端口

为了确保网站可以正常访问,需要在防火墙中开放相应的端口。以下是一个示例表格,展示了需要开放的端口和对应的协议:

端口号 协议 描述
80 HTTP 用于Web浏览
443 HTTPS 用于安全Web浏览
21 FTP 用于文件传输

在防火墙设置中,为上述端口添加相应的规则,并允许出站和入站流量。请注意,不同操作系统的防火墙设置方法可能有所不同。

通过以上步骤,您已经完成了ASP网站的权限设置和防火墙配置。接下来,您可以启动网站并访问URL进行测试,确保网站功能正常运行。

四、启动网站与功能测试

1、启动IIS中的网站

在IIS管理器中,找到你创建的ASP网站,选择该网站,右键点击,然后选择“启动”。此时,IIS会为你的ASP网站分配一个唯一的IP地址和端口,以便用户可以访问。

2、通过URL访问网站

启动网站后,你可以通过以下URL格式访问网站:

http://IP地址:端口/网站目录

例如,如果你的IP地址是192.168.1.100,端口是8080,网站目录是“myasp”,则URL为:

http://192.168.1.100:8080/myasp

将此URL复制到浏览器地址栏中,按回车键,如果一切设置正确,你应该能看到你的ASP网站。

3、检查网站功能是否正常

访问网站后,仔细检查网站的功能是否正常。以下是一些检查要点:

  • 网站首页是否正确显示
  • 网站的导航是否正常工作
  • 是否可以成功提交表单
  • 图片、链接等元素是否正常显示
  • 是否存在任何错误信息

如果在测试过程中发现任何问题,请返回之前设置的部分,检查并修复错误。

表1:ASP网站功能测试要点

测试要点 描述
网站首页显示 确保网站首页正确显示,页面布局符合预期
导航功能 确保网站导航链接正确跳转至对应页面
表单提交 检查表单提交功能,确保数据正确传递到服务器并处理
图片、链接显示 确保网站中的图片、链接等元素正确显示,无错误链接或死链现象
错误信息 确保网站在遇到错误时能给出清晰、友好的错误信息,方便调试

通过以上步骤,你可以成功启动ASP网站并进行功能测试。如果测试过程中遇到任何问题,请仔细检查设置并修复错误。祝你在ASP网站的开发过程中一切顺利!

结语:顺利运行ASP网站的要点回顾

在完成ASP网站的安装、配置与测试后,顺利运行ASP网站的关键要点可总结如下:

  1. 安装与配置IIS服务器:选择合适的操作系统,下载并安装IIS服务器,配置基本设置,确保服务器能够支持ASP应用程序。

  2. 创建与配置ASP网站:在IIS管理器中创建新网站,设置网站目录与端口,上传ASP文件至服务器目录,确保文件路径正确。

  3. 权限设置与防火墙配置:设置网站目录权限,确保应用程序有足够的权限运行。配置防火墙以开放端口,允许外部访问。

  4. 启动网站与功能测试:启动IIS中的网站,通过URL访问网站,检查网站功能是否正常,确保应用程序运行无误。

  5. 持续学习与解决实际问题:遇到问题时,不要气馁,通过查阅相关资料、咨询同行或寻求专业帮助,不断提升自己的技能。

通过以上要点回顾,相信您已经具备了运行ASP网站的基本技能。接下来,勇敢地实践吧!在不断尝试与探索中,您将逐渐成长为ASP网站开发的专家。同时,也欢迎您分享自己的经验与心得,让我们一起进步。

常见问题

  1. 运行ASP网站需要哪些硬件和软件要求?运行ASP网站通常需要一台性能稳定的计算机作为服务器,硬件配置包括CPU、内存、硬盘等。软件方面,需安装支持ASP的操作系统,如Windows Server系列,并安装IIS服务器。

  2. 如何解决IIS安装过程中遇到的问题?IIS安装过程中遇到问题可能由于操作系统版本不兼容、IIS组件缺失等原因引起。可先检查操作系统是否支持IIS安装,确保IIS组件已正确安装。如果问题依旧,可以尝试重新安装IIS或查找相关论坛、文档寻找解决方案。

  3. 网站无法访问时如何排查原因?网站无法访问时,可以先检查IIS中的网站配置是否正确,如网站目录、端口设置等。然后检查服务器防火墙是否阻断了相关端口。如果问题依旧,可以尝试在浏览器中直接访问服务器IP地址,排查网络问题。

  4. 如何优化ASP网站的运行速度?优化ASP网站运行速度可以从以下几个方面入手:优化代码,减少数据库查询,缓存常用数据,调整服务器配置,选择合适的Web服务器软件等。

  5. 如何保障ASP网站的安全性?保障ASP网站安全性需要从以下几个方面考虑:设置强密码,定期更换密码,限制登录次数,安装杀毒软件,定期备份网站数据,设置合适的文件权限,避免SQL注入等安全漏洞。

原创文章,作者:路飞练拳的地方,如若转载,请注明出处:https://www.shuziqianzhan.com/article/34206.html

Like (0)
路飞练拳的地方的头像路飞练拳的地方研究员
Previous 2025-06-08 23:26
Next 2025-06-08 23:26

相关推荐

  • 网页设计发展前景怎么样

    网页设计的发展前景广阔,随着互联网技术的不断进步,企业对高质量网站的需求日益增加。UI/UX设计的重视使得网页设计师需不断提升创意和技术能力。移动端和响应式设计的普及也为行业带来新机遇,薪资待遇和职业发展空间均看好。

    2025-06-17
    0153
  • 织梦cms怎么本地搭建

    要在本地搭建织梦CMS,首先下载最新版本的织梦安装包。解压后,将其放置在本地服务器的根目录(如XAMPP的htdocs)。接着,创建数据库并在织梦安装向导中填写数据库信息。按照向导提示完成安装,最后访问本地域名即可进入织梦后台进行管理。

    2025-06-11
    02
  • 交互体验包括什么

    交互体验包括界面设计、操作流畅性、信息反馈和用户引导。良好的界面设计让用户第一眼感觉舒适,操作流畅性确保用户在使用过程中不会遇到卡顿,信息反馈让用户明确操作结果,用户引导则帮助新手快速上手。综合这些要素,才能打造出优质的交互体验。

    2025-06-19
    0143
  • 如何添加二级域名

    要添加二级域名,首先登录到你的域名管理面板,选择需要添加二级的主域名。接着找到“子域名管理”或类似选项,点击“添加子域名”,输入你想要的二级域名前缀,如“blog”。然后配置DNS解析,添加A记录或CNAME记录指向你的服务器IP或目标域名。保存设置后,等待DNS解析生效,通常需要几个小时到一天。

  • 如何修改cms目录

    要修改CMS目录,首先登录到网站后台,找到文件管理或目录设置选项。备份原目录结构以防万一。根据CMS类型(如WordPress、Drupal等),选择相应的目录进行修改,确保路径正确无误。更新后,检查网站功能是否正常,避免出现404错误。最后,更新sitemap并提交给搜索引擎,确保SEO不受影响。

  • 响应式网站如何实现

    响应式网站通过使用媒体查询、弹性布局和可伸缩单位等技术实现。媒体查询允许根据不同设备屏幕尺寸调整样式,弹性布局确保元素自适应屏幕大小,而可伸缩单位如百分比和em则保证元素的相对大小。结合这些技术,网站能在各种设备上提供一致的用户体验。

  • 哪些运算符不能重载

    在C++中,不能重载的运算符包括::(域解析运算符)、.*(成员指针访问运算符)、->*(成员指针访问运算符)以及sizeof(大小运算符)。这些运算符由于其特殊用途和语言设计的原因,被禁止重载,以确保代码的稳定性和一致性。

    2025-06-15
    0391
  • 外贸怎么找网红做广告

    寻找外贸网红合作,首先要明确目标市场和产品定位,通过社交媒体平台如Instagram、YouTube筛选相关领域的网红。关注其粉丝量、互动率和内容质量,确保与品牌形象契合。主动联系并发送详细合作提案,明确合作方式和预期效果,签订合同保障双方权益。

    2025-06-11
    01
  • 自适应网页有哪些尺寸

    自适应网页设计的核心在于响应不同设备的屏幕尺寸。常见的自适应尺寸包括320px(手机)、480px(小屏手机)、768px(平板)、1024px(笔记本电脑)和1280px(桌面显示器)。通过使用媒体查询(Media Queries),网页能根据设备宽度自动调整布局和样式,确保用户体验的一致性。

    2025-06-15
    0211

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注